BIG beat Astralis to qualify for BLAST Premier Spring Finals

The Danish team have been knocked down to the Showdown stage.

BIG have joined Ninjas in Pyjamas in qualifying for the BLAST Premier Spring Finals from Group A following a 2-0 victory over Astralis in the consolidation final. The German team scraped a 16-14 win on Vertigo after punishing the Danes with weak buys late in the game and then ran riot on Inferno, where they managed to overcome a 1-6 deficit with some stellar AWPing by Florian "⁠syrsoN⁠" Rische, who went 9-0 in opening kills and had 21 frags with the 'Big Green'.

After the match, Astralis coach Danny "⁠zonic⁠" Sørensen admitted to being disappointed with the result and rued the team's mistakes. The current world No.1 will have less than two weeks to fix their shortcomings and consistency issues before the main stage of IEM Katowice, in which $1 million will be on the line.

Peter "⁠dupreeh⁠" Rasmussen opened the game with a quad-kill in the pistol round, firing Astralis into an early lead on Vertigo, BIG's map pick. But the complexion of the game changed once both teams had money to work with: The rounds that Astralis edged out from that point were few and far between as BIG took control of proceedings, with Nils "⁠k1to⁠" Gruhne and Ismailcan "⁠XANTARES⁠" Dörtkardeş playing a central role as the German team picked up a 9-6 lead.

The second half began with a 1v2 clutch from Johannes "⁠tabseN⁠" Wodarz, but there was no follow-up as Astralis hit back immediately on a force-buy. The Danish team enjoyed a spell of dominance and eventually reduced the deficit to a solitary round, but then the game turned into a scrappy affair as neither side managed to assume control of the contest. In the end, two unlikely wins on shoddy buys saw BIG come out on top.

Astralis enjoyed a flying start on Inferno, strolling to a 6-1 lead on the T side off the back of an ace by dupreeh in a hectic pistol round. But then they met a brick wall in the form of syrsoN. The German AWPer, who had endured a quiet game on Vertigo, racked up 17 frags in the rest of the half to inspire BIG to a fantastic comeback, with Tizian "⁠tiziaN⁠" Feldbusch also proving key with two great individual plays, including a 1v3 clutch in the final round to give his team an 8-7 lead.

More misery was to come for Astralis, who lost the opening five rounds of the second half. The Danes then managed to put their foot down and bring BIG's streak to an end, but the German side responded immediately with nothing but pistols and simply ran away with the game.
